Output 3d8d94e448b91131d55aa5f49e2d2df21a2814242aa44fbc44e42f108169c864:1

value
49535766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f1c3cd615baa5567862712d47b47d3bd2d965e OP_EQUAL
address
3HYkSr57QUARzpxofVXBVz5cpXyY6Lv43N
transaction
3d8d94e448b91131d55aa5f49e2d2df21a2814242aa44fbc44e42f108169c864
spent
true